5 Easy Facts About what is md5 technology Described
5 Easy Facts About what is md5 technology Described
Blog Article
An MD5 hash is sixteen bytes prolonged (or 128 bits). The length of the MD5 hash is often exactly the same at 32 alphanumerical characters, no matter what the initial file dimension is. An MD5 hash case in point is “5d41402abc4b2a76b9719d911017c592,” and that is the hash worth with the phrase “hi there.”
It absolutely was developed by Ronald Rivest in 1991 and is also principally used to confirm details integrity. Nonetheless, as a consequence of its vulnerability to various attacks, MD5 is currently deemed insecure and has been largely changed by a lot more strong hashing algorithms like SHA-256.
This tells you that the file is corrupted. This really is only efficient when the info has become unintentionally corrupted, on the other hand, rather than in the situation of destructive tampering.
Info integrity verification. MD5 is usually accustomed to verify the integrity of documents or data. By evaluating the MD5 hash of a downloaded file which has a recognised, reliable hash, customers can affirm that the file hasn't been altered or corrupted throughout transmission.
Danger actors can force collisions that could then send out a digital signature that could be accepted with the receiver. Although It's not necessarily the actual sender, the collision delivers the same hash value Hence the danger actor’s message is going to be confirmed and accepted as genuine. What systems use MD5?
Collision Resistance: MD5 was initially collision-resistant, as two different inputs that provide a similar click here hash price really should be computationally extremely hard. In practice, however, vulnerabilities that help collision assaults have already been found.
They found that each and every a person experienced MD5 certificates linked to their networks. In whole, over 17 p.c of your certificates utilized to indicator servers, code, and VPN accessibility nevertheless utilized the MD5 algorithm.
Nonetheless, it's important to note that these methods can only make MD5 safer, although not entirely Protected. Technologies have progressed, and so provide the tactics to crack them.
And there you have it—the internal workings of your MD5 algorithm in the nutshell. It is really a complex course of action, certain, but think about it as being a relentless arithmetic-run safety guard, tirelessly Performing to keep your info Risk-free and seem.
Passwords saved making use of md5 is usually very easily cracked by hackers applying these strategies. It is usually recommended to utilize much better cryptographic hash functions, for example SHA-256 or bcrypt, for password storage.
Greg can be a technologist and details geek with more than ten years in tech. He has labored in a variety of industries as an IT supervisor and program tester. Greg is definitely an avid writer on anything IT related, from cyber safety to troubleshooting. Far more from the author
Moving a person Place towards the remaining, we provide the amount “c”, which is really just twelve in hexadecimal. Given that it is the 3rd digit from the correct, this time we multiply it by sixteen to the strength of two.
Flame applied MD5 hash collisions to crank out copyright Microsoft update certificates utilized to authenticate important devices. Fortuitously, the vulnerability was learned promptly, and also a software package update was issued to shut this safety hole. This involved switching to using SHA-one for Microsoft certificates.
Even with its Original intention, MD5 is looked upon as broken as a result of its vulnerability to varied assault vectors. Collisions, the place two various inputs deliver exactly the same hash worth, can be produced with relative ease working with modern-day computational ability. Consequently, MD5 is not proposed for cryptographic needs, such as password storage.